January 26, 1970: Kirk Franklin is born. He was raised by his aunt after his mum abandoned him as a baby. Kirk Franklin in his teens drifted from his religious upbringing during which he got a girl pregnant and was consequently expelled from school. He, however, got back to God after witnessing his friend shot dead at the age of 15. Kirk Franklin grew to become an award winning Gospel singer and choir director with 16 Grammy awards amongst others.
January 26, 1976: Tyrone “Tye” Tribbett is born into a family of Gospel ministers, Bishop Thomas Tyrone and Neicy Tribbett and raised in an Apostolic Pentecostal Church in Camden. Tye Tribbett is an award winning Gospel singer, songwriter and choir director. He’s also the founder of Tye Tribbett and Greater Anointing, an award-winning gospel group. He, together with his wife, Shante, are resident pastors at the Live Church in Orlando Florida. USA
January 26, 1968: Pastor Chris Abraham is born. Pastor Chris served as a Pastor in the Living Faith Church and later founded the Kingdom Prevailers International Christian Centre (Prevailers Assembly), Abuja. Nigeria
January 26, 1859: Millionaire inventor of the reaper, Cyrus McCormick, marries Nettie Fowler, a devoted Christian. Following Cyrus’s death in 1884, Nettie used her enormous wealth to establish Chicago’s McCormick Theological Seminary and to support the work of D.L. Moody, John R. Mott, and countless missionaries to Asia.
January 26, 1906: The Church of God (Cleveland, Tennessee), the oldest Pentecostal denomination, convenes its first General Assembly.
